The research of mineral resources in Mozambique during recent years has induced the influx of small to large mining companies to conduct numerous exploration projects, especially in the north-western parts and the coastal zones of the country, some of which have been proved to be feasible for exploitation, having resulted in small to large scale mines to be in construction already or within the next months and years to come.
During the exploration projects it was found that soil and drilling samples could not be analysed in Mozambique as there was and still is no chemical laboratory in the country that has the capability to analyse samples from coal and base metal exploration projects, which require highly specialised analysis methods and high-tech equipment. Therefore samples were sent to Europe, America, Australia and South Africa for analysis resulting in high cost and long turn-around times due to transport issues.
Therefore in 2006 ACT-UIS Laboratórios de Moçambique, Lda. a Mozambican private commercial laboratory company, which has three equal (33.33%) shareholders (Advanced Coal Technology (Pty) Ltd., South Africa, UIS Analytical Services (Pty) Ltd., South Africa, and PlurInvest Lda., a Mozambican investment company), was formed to supply an analytical service to these companies, a first in Mozambique.
